With high winds up high at South and the subsequent closure of Heaven’s Gate. North had it chance to shine.
North skied some of the best I can remember.
Early season snafus and the subsequent late snow making start in combination with the high winds and upper lift closures did also show one of our weaknesses. Not having North Lynx open till late in the week and Steins not offering a lower MT expert option ended up over crowding the lower MT. At one point the Brovo singles line extended up to the entrance of the Valley House Cafeteria door. Only to be passed by the Valley House lift line extending back in the opposite direction. This also ended up over crowding the open trails which facilitated being hit hard by a tourist on the high traverse just above the top of Valley House Lift.
